A unidirectional microphone is designed to capture sound primarily from one direction while minimizing noise from other angles. This feature makes it particularly useful in environments where background noise can interfere with the desired audio, such as interviews or live performances. The design allows for better sound isolation and enhances the clarity of the captured audio by focusing on the source of sound directly in front of the microphone.
